├── .gitignore ├── .gitmodules ├── LICENSE ├── README.md ├── circuits ├── pow_mod.circom └── rsa_verify.circom ├── contracts ├── README.md ├── contracts │ └── RsaVerify.sol ├── migrations │ └── 1_initial_rsa_verify.js ├── run-ganache.sh ├── test │ └── Test_SigVer15_186-3.js └── truffle_config.js ├── package.json ├── test ├── circuits │ ├── pow_mod_64_32.circom │ └── rsa_verify_pkcs1v15.circom ├── test_pow_mod.ts └── test_rsa_pkcs1v15.ts ├── tsconfig.json └── yarn.lock /.gitignore: -------------------------------------------------------------------------------- 1 | node_modules -------------------------------------------------------------------------------- /.gitmodules: -------------------------------------------------------------------------------- https://raw.githubusercontent.com/zkp-application/circom-rsa-verify/HEAD/.gitmodules -------------------------------------------------------------------------------- /LICENSE: -------------------------------------------------------------------------------- https://raw.githubusercontent.com/zkp-application/circom-rsa-verify/HEAD/LICENSE -------------------------------------------------------------------------------- /README.md: -------------------------------------------------------------------------------- https://raw.githubusercontent.com/zkp-application/circom-rsa-verify/HEAD/README.md -------------------------------------------------------------------------------- /circuits/pow_mod.circom: -------------------------------------------------------------------------------- https://raw.githubusercontent.com/zkp-application/circom-rsa-verify/HEAD/circuits/pow_mod.circom -------------------------------------------------------------------------------- /circuits/rsa_verify.circom: -------------------------------------------------------------------------------- https://raw.githubusercontent.com/zkp-application/circom-rsa-verify/HEAD/circuits/rsa_verify.circom -------------------------------------------------------------------------------- /contracts/README.md: -------------------------------------------------------------------------------- https://raw.githubusercontent.com/zkp-application/circom-rsa-verify/HEAD/contracts/README.md -------------------------------------------------------------------------------- /contracts/contracts/RsaVerify.sol: -------------------------------------------------------------------------------- https://raw.githubusercontent.com/zkp-application/circom-rsa-verify/HEAD/contracts/contracts/RsaVerify.sol -------------------------------------------------------------------------------- /contracts/migrations/1_initial_rsa_verify.js: -------------------------------------------------------------------------------- https://raw.githubusercontent.com/zkp-application/circom-rsa-verify/HEAD/contracts/migrations/1_initial_rsa_verify.js -------------------------------------------------------------------------------- /contracts/run-ganache.sh: -------------------------------------------------------------------------------- 1 | #!/bin/sh 2 | npx ganache-cli --networkId=1 3 | -------------------------------------------------------------------------------- /contracts/test/Test_SigVer15_186-3.js: -------------------------------------------------------------------------------- https://raw.githubusercontent.com/zkp-application/circom-rsa-verify/HEAD/contracts/test/Test_SigVer15_186-3.js -------------------------------------------------------------------------------- /contracts/truffle_config.js: -------------------------------------------------------------------------------- https://raw.githubusercontent.com/zkp-application/circom-rsa-verify/HEAD/contracts/truffle_config.js -------------------------------------------------------------------------------- /package.json: -------------------------------------------------------------------------------- https://raw.githubusercontent.com/zkp-application/circom-rsa-verify/HEAD/package.json -------------------------------------------------------------------------------- /test/circuits/pow_mod_64_32.circom: -------------------------------------------------------------------------------- https://raw.githubusercontent.com/zkp-application/circom-rsa-verify/HEAD/test/circuits/pow_mod_64_32.circom -------------------------------------------------------------------------------- /test/circuits/rsa_verify_pkcs1v15.circom: -------------------------------------------------------------------------------- https://raw.githubusercontent.com/zkp-application/circom-rsa-verify/HEAD/test/circuits/rsa_verify_pkcs1v15.circom -------------------------------------------------------------------------------- /test/test_pow_mod.ts: -------------------------------------------------------------------------------- https://raw.githubusercontent.com/zkp-application/circom-rsa-verify/HEAD/test/test_pow_mod.ts -------------------------------------------------------------------------------- /test/test_rsa_pkcs1v15.ts: -------------------------------------------------------------------------------- https://raw.githubusercontent.com/zkp-application/circom-rsa-verify/HEAD/test/test_rsa_pkcs1v15.ts -------------------------------------------------------------------------------- /tsconfig.json: -------------------------------------------------------------------------------- https://raw.githubusercontent.com/zkp-application/circom-rsa-verify/HEAD/tsconfig.json -------------------------------------------------------------------------------- /yarn.lock: -------------------------------------------------------------------------------- https://raw.githubusercontent.com/zkp-application/circom-rsa-verify/HEAD/yarn.lock --------------------------------------------------------------------------------